- Assumes first-line supervision of location employees. Ensures company policies and procedures are followed.
- Coordinates daily transit operations' dispatching and in-service monitoring.
- Completes necessary daily and/or weekly reports for company and customer.
- Tracks and maintains employee attendance system and processes driver and operations staff vacation requests. Maintains/orders necessary driver and staff uniforms.
- Monitors and evaluates Operations activities. Includes: vehicle on-time statistics, missed runs, customer complaint data, accident data, road call data, and other operations-related functions
- Assists with supervision of location staff. Communicates job requirements and expectations. Monitors the performance of staff and provides coaching and guidance as required.
- Shall be fully trained and capable of running other departments in the event of a vacancy.
- In conjunction with the Safety Manager, ensures all federal, state, local and company recordkeeping requirements are met.
- May assists in accident/incident investigation, including any needed on-site assistance and support to safety and training personnel.
- Coordinates with the safety and training department to ensure all safety goals and directives are met.
- Ensures that all manifests are performed accurately and timely.
- Manage Dispatch and Operator schedules and validation of pay hours.
- Assigns manifests and documents assignments manually and in the specified computer system; updates and maintains dispatch.
- Assists with operator hiring process; administers discipline to operators including recommendations for suspension or termination; oversees activities and supervises driver's room; documents attendance and enforces uniform policy; counsels' employees.
- Performs any other management requests or directives as they relate to the overall function of Transdev. In addition, shall maintain the appropriate license requirement to drive a route as necessary to complete the day's activity.
